We are currently accepting applications for the position of Client Support and Implementation Specialist
The Client Support and Implementation Specialist 1 (CSIS1) is responsible for implementing new name and back to base sales, answering complex questions, contributing to a knowledge base, and advocating for the needs of the client. The CSIS is accountable for ensuring continuity of computer system services by providing the technical expertise, the assistance and project coordination necessary to maintain computer software products, and resolve technical problems.
What your impact will be:
- Configure new systems and features and train clients how to use iCarol to best meet their organizations’ needs
- Monitors and answers incoming support chats and tickets, working directly with customers to help solve problems
- Resolves issues or escalates issues to CSIS2 when more expertise is needed
- Assists with release management by testing bug fixes and software enhancements, and other upgrade rollout tasks as required
- Stay abreast on the latest developments in software through self-learning/training
- Uses discretion to effect timely solution of problems to ensure customer satisfaction, eliminate downtime and prevent cost overruns
- Maintains client relationships
- Aids in creating and providing support documentation
- Identifies solutions for customers related to potential up sales, escalating to the Sales Team when needed
- Exercises sound professional judgment in analysis of problems to: (1) attempt hardware/software solution by screenshare, or (2) decide proper level of maintenance required to solve problem
- Other duties as assigned
What we are looking for:
- Honesty, patience, and motivation are core values of the iCarol team
- A passionate belief in the mission of help lines and respect for their callers
- A high degree of responsiveness to client requests and issues
- Strong proficiency and comfort using computers and the web
- General to intermediate knowledge of computers, internet browsers (Internet Explorer, Google Chrome, Mozilla Firefox, etc.) and Microsoft Office products (Word, Excel, PowerPoint)
- Project management skills will be a plus
- Due to the nature of the work our clients do (ie. you will have access to client ePHI), our policies require you to sign a confidentiality agreement and pass a basic criminal background check in addition to annual HIPAA security training.
What will make you standout?
- At least 2 years of experience working at a help line, preferably both on the phones and in an administrative role
- At least 2 years of experience as an iCarol Admin
- Bachelor’s degree preferred
